How Donald Trump's remittance tax is threatening property investments in Kenya

Workers at Affordable housing at Lumumba in Kisumu city, traders taking opportunities that are cropping up from the project. [Michael Mute, Standard]

Kenya's real estate sector could be staring at another shock following the American government's move to tax diaspora remittances.

The move follows the signing into law of President Donald Trump's "One Big Beautiful Bill" on July 4, 2025.
